About The Position

As an Experienced Screen Printer at Rebel Athletic, you will be hands-on in producing premium prints for apparel and accessories that meet our high-quality standards. We specialize in premium water-based and plastisol screen printing using industry-leading M&R automatic equipment, so you’ll work with top-tier tools to ensure the highest level of precision and finish. You will operate and maintain screen-printing equipment, mix inks, ensure accuracy in color and placement, and help deliver flawless products to our customers. This role is perfect for someone detail-oriented, quality-focused, and ready to thrive in a fast-paced production environment. We design and produce retail-ready gear in-house, specializing in water-based and plastisol screen printing on industry-leading M&R automatic equipment, as well as crystal decoration and custom finishing. Our team is built around craftsmanship, speed, and an uncompromising eye for quality. We are seeking a highly skilled Screen Printer / Press Operator to join our production team. The ideal candidate has extensive experience running M&R automatic presses and producing high-quality prints using both water-based and plastisol inks. You will be responsible for setting up, operating, and maintaining presses to deliver consistent, retail-ready results on every job.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of professional screen printing experience on M&R automatic presses.
  • Strong knowledge of both water-based and plastisol printing techniques.
  • Ability to perform complex setups, including simulated process and specialty inks.
  • Familiarity with proper mesh counts, emulsions, and screen preparation for different ink types.
  • Keen eye for detail and color accuracy.
  • Ability to troubleshoot and resolve technical printing issues independently.
  • Strong work ethic and ability to meet production deadlines.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ience with discharge, specialty inks, and high-end retail printing.
  • Knowledge of prepress workflow (film output, screen coating, exposure).
  • Basic press maintenance skills.

Responsibilities

  • Operate and maintain M&R automatic presses for production runs.
  • Perform accurate setup, registration, and calibration for multi-color jobs.
  • Mix, manage, and handle water-based and plastisol inks to achieve required colors and finishes.
  • Conduct quality checks throughout production to ensure color accuracy, placement, and print consistency.
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of the press area, screens, and tools.
  • Troubleshoot press, screen, and ink issues quickly to minimize downtime.
  • Work closely with the production team to meet deadlines while maintaining the highest print standards.
  • Follow safety procedures and proper handling of chemicals and equipment.
